Output 792429b54045c7a5d8c8deefb4f8f93968cd3e621e5d2b8a26f57feef45b6376:19

value
510311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df84e950604f24ecc038b9c17b54343bb06e2613 OP_EQUAL
address
3N4sqAd3jXMqTF6DeGWmHMpVZsjU5bKhqD
transaction
792429b54045c7a5d8c8deefb4f8f93968cd3e621e5d2b8a26f57feef45b6376
confirmations
160505
spent
true